While this seems to be a bad idea, I can see two ways of doing it :
< followed by anything but the % character, then ignoring it(<)(?:[^%])
The [^] sequence allows you to search for anything but the following character.
The (?:) sequence is for non capturing groups.
<(?!%)
The (?!) sequence succeeds if it doesn't match the following character, but is not captured.
%>, you can just "reverse" the first option :(?:[^%])(>)
(careful here, the lookahead won't work as you need to go backwards)
(?<!%)>
